Официальное название

Digital Exergame Neurorehabilitation to Enhance Quality of Life and Functional Autonomy in Institutionalized Older Adults With Mild Cognitive Impairment: Randomized Controlled Trial

Обзор

The goal of this clinical trial is to learn whether a semi-autonomous digital telerehabilitation program using therapeutic video games ("exergames") can help improve quality of life and functional independence in older adults living in long-term care centers who have mild cognitive impairment (MCI). The main questions we want to answer are: Does this exergame-based program help participants move better, walk more safely, and perform daily activities with more independence? Does it improve confidence while moving and lower the fear of falling? Is this program cost-effective compared with a standard one-to-one physiotherapy program? Researchers will compare two groups: Intervention group: participants will use a CE-marked digital rehabilitation platform that provides lower-limb and balance training through interactive exergames. Control group: participants will receive an individual physiotherapy program of similar duration and intensity. Participants will: Take part in a 6-week training program (using exergames or standard physiotherapy, depending on their group). Complete tests that measure mobility, balance, walking while doing a cognitive task (called "dual task"), confidence in avoiding falls, and daily functioning. Answer short questionnaires about well-being and quality of life. This pilot study will help determine whether the exergame-based program is safe, useful, and feasible for older adults with MCI living in long-term care settings.

Вмешательства

  • Поведенческое Digital exergame-based neurorehabilitation program
    Participants will perform interactive exergame-based exercises targeting lower-limb strength, balance, postural control, and cognitive-motor interaction. Exercises progressively increase in difficulty and incorporate tasks that require simultaneous physical movement and cognitive processing (dual-task training). Intervention Dose: Three sessions per week for eight weeks. Each session lasts 30-40 minutes. Follow-Up: Outcome assessments at baseline (V0), week 8 (V8), and week 16 (V16) to exami
  • Поведенческое Individual conventional physiotherapy
    Sessions include traditional balance exercises, strength training for the lower limbs, gait practice, and functional mobility activities conducted by a physiotherapist. Intervention Dose: Three sessions per week for eight weeks. Session duration is equivalent to the experimental group. Follow-Up: Outcome assessments at baseline (V0), week 8 (V8), and week 16 (V16).

Первичные конечные точки

  • Global Cognitive Function (Montreal Cognitive Assessment, MoCA; 0-30) [Срок оценки: Baseline (V0), Week 8 (V1, end of treatment), Week 16 (V2, follow-up)]
  • Executive Functions (Trail Making Test, Part A and Part B; completion time in seconds)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Gait Speed Under Single-Task Conditions (10-Meter Walk Test; meters/second)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Dual-Task Cost in Gait Speed (percentage)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Health-Related Quality of Life (EQ-5D-5L Index Score)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
Вторичные конечные точки (5)
  • Short Physical Performance Battery (SPPB; 0-12)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Instrumental Activities of Daily Living (Lawton-Brody IADL; total score)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Fear of Falling (Short Falls Efficacy Scale-International; total score)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Mood (Geriatric Depression Scale, 15-item; total score)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]
  • Functional Strength (Five Times Sit-to-Stand; seconds) [Срок оценки: Baseline (V0), Week 8 (V1), Week 16 (V2)]

Критерии участия

Критерии включения

  • Age 70 years or older.
  • Diagnosis of mild cognitive impairment, defined by Montreal Cognitive Assessment (MoCA) score between 18 and 25.
  • Ability to maintain standing and/or ambulate with or without assistive devices.
  • Institutional residence for at least 3 months.
  • Informed consent provided by participant or legal representative.

Критерии исключения

  • Acute illness, musculoskeletal condition, or pain that limits safe participation in training.
  • Uncompensated sensory deficits (vision or hearing) that interfere with task performance.
  • Disruptive behavior or neuropsychiatric symptoms that impede participation.
  • Active epilepsy or medical contraindications for physical exercise.
